The role ofin vitromethods as alternatives to animals in toxicity testing

Abstract: There is a transfer of toxicological data from primary in vivo animal studies to in vitro assays. The key element for designing an integrated in vitro testing strategy is summarized as follows: exposure modeling of chemical agents for in vitro testing; data gathering, sharing and read-across for testing a class of chemical; a battery of tests to assemble a broad spectrum of data on different mechanisms of action to predict toxic effects; and applicability of the test and the integrated in vitro testing strateg… Show more

“…The utilization of cell lines is relatively rapid, cost-effective, and can reduce, refine or replace (3R principle) acute lethality tests using animals (Segner, 2004;Castaño and Gómez-Lechón, 2005). In the recent decades, in vitro assays with cells have been applied for toxicity mechanism studies and are becoming of growing importance in mechanistic toxicology (Fryer and Lannan, 1994;Fent, 2001;Anadón et al, 2014).…”
